Subject: Cut-over complete — Larkspool cache fix. Quick summary for you as the incoming contractor. We finished the cut-over last night following the stale-cache postmortem: the old invalidation daemon is retired, and Larkspool now purges on write instead of on a timer. Read the postmortem doc before making cache changes — the bug came from two services disagreeing on TTLs. Traffic has been clean for twelve hours. For reference while you ramp up, the cache layer now runs with the following values.

config for kafof-bawef:
holath:
  log_level: debug
  metrics_host: metrics.holath.qorvelsys.internal
  pin: 2191
  pool_size: 32

Careful review of the Larkspool hermetic migration: the sandbox now pins toolchain versions, so on-call should expect cache misses after each toolchain bump rather than silent drift. I verified outputs are bit-identical across two builders. One caveat: remote cache eviction pressure rises during release weeks. The tuning constants the scheduler uses are as follows.

tuning table, yajog-yahof:
BUDGETS = {
    "lamvan": 303,
    "wenox": 460,
    "fenvan": 525,
}

**Ticket: Vault locked — Widegrain diff viewer release artifacts**

The vault holding the signed build of the Widegrain large-file diff viewer locked itself after three failed unseal attempts during last night's release rehearsal. The 2.4 release cannot ship until it's reopened. Per the custodial rotation, unsealing requires the recovery passphrase recorded directly below this ticket.

unlock words, hahip-baduf: holwyn-istath-julvan

## Tuning

Scrubjay strips EXIF blocks in a streaming pass, so memory use depends mostly on chunk size and the tag allowlist depth. Plugin authors overriding the scrub pipeline should keep chunk size a multiple of the marker-scan window, or partial APP1 segments can slip through. Larger values speed up batch scrubbing but raise peak memory per worker. The defaults we ship are:

limits module of tafof-kagef:
RATE_LIMITS = {
    "zorix": 10,
    "ralath": 1,
    "quenwyn": 2,
    "holael": 10,
}